-=> Quoting Paul Edwards to David Nugent <=- Hello Paul, DN> On some platforms (not intel), the option of accessing data at DN> other than alignment boundaries of a size determined by the DN> machine is not available. PE> Could you tell me the name of one such machine? On IBM S/370 PE> machines it just makes it slower, so I don't have any real life PE> examples of it being not allowed at all, although I don't doubt PE> that there are. All data must be aligned on the Motorola 68000, but the 68020 & above are more forgiving. Michael Stapleton of Graphic Bits. * AmyBW v2.10 * ...
